Turn a PowerPoint, a photo, or a live data feed into a video stream playing on any smart TV. The lunch menu on the screen in reception. Opening hours in a shop window. A noticeboard in a school corridor. Room information in a hotel lobby. A live numbers board in an office.
This repo is the infoslides binary: one dependency-free executable that is both a developer
CLI and an MCP server for AI agents like Claude Code,
Claude Desktop, and Cursor.
The interesting part is that create_tenant is anonymous. An agent with this server installed can
take someone from no account at all to content playing on a physical screen — provision the
workspace, upload the deck, register the display, assign the schedule, hand back the stream link —
without anyone opening a dashboard. As far as we know, no other digital signage platform can be
driven that way.
New workspaces land on a permanent free plan: 1 screen, 4 slideshows, 2 users, 200 MB. No credit card, no trial clock, nothing expires. The whole flow below costs nothing and keeps running.

27 tools, covering the whole path: workspace provisioning (create_tenant, anonymous, returns
the admin key), slideshows including direct .pptx upload (upload_pptx), media slides by URL or
direct file upload (upload_media), visibility conditions (time of day, weekday, data triggers),
self-updating template slides driven by live data pushes (update_source), devices, schedules with
AspectMismatch warnings, HLS stream links, PNG slide previews for self-verification, API keys
including push-only keys scoped to a single slide, and Paddle upgrade links. The backend enforces
every plan limit — the tool layer cannot bypass them.
A Skill, which is the judgement the tools do not carry: when a self-updating slide beats a fixed one, how to pick between landscape and portrait, how long a slide should stay up for someone queueing versus someone walking past, and how to talk a person through the TV end of it while they are holding a remote.

No install route notifies you of a new release on its own, so the binary checks for one itself: at
most once a day, in the background, cached to ~/.infoslides/update-check.json. The notice goes to
stderr in CLI mode (so --json output stays clean and pipeable) and into the server
instructions in --mcp mode, where an agent can pass it on.
The check never sits on the critical path — the notice you see comes from the cache and the refresh
is for next time — so no command is slower for it and being offline costs nothing. Set
INFOSLIDES_NO_UPDATE_CHECK=1 to switch it off; it also disables itself when CI is set.

dotnet build # AOT analyzers run as errors — keep it warning-free
dotnet test # unit + MCP end-to-end tests (no network needed)The MCP SDK tools are registered via the AOT-safe WithTools<T>() path; every wire type must be
listed in InfoSlidesJsonContext (a test fails if one is missing). In --mcp mode stdout is the
protocol — log only to stderr.
Tool descriptions are trigger text, not documentation: a model matches them against what the user
just said, so they lead with the situation ("register the physical screen — the TV in reception,
the menu board above the counter") rather than the API operation. Tests in
McpStdioSmokeTests pin that vocabulary so it cannot quietly regress.
